POSITION OVERVIEW
Reporting to the Senior Vice President, Fleet Management Operations, the Developer functions with considerable independence and initiative and is responsible for researching, designing, and developing computer and network software or specialized programs. This role analyzes user and business needs, updates existing software capabilities, and develops software solutions. This role consistently utilizes independent judgment and discretion and works closely with internal and external stakeholders to modify existing software to correct errors, upgrade interfaces and improve performance. Ultimately, the Developer works to ensure the optimization of internal systems and serves as a trusted advisor to leadership by offering strategic recommendations and responsive support.

QUALIFICATIONS, SKILLS AND EXPERIENCE
Bachelor's degree in computer science, engineering, or a related field required.
At least five years of recent relevant experience required.
Proficiency in SQL programming required, including creating tables, querying, updating, deleting data, managing keys, and defining relationships between tables.
Familiarity with application languages likeC#, Python, Java, et al strongly
Strong preference for experience with VesonIMOS, Nautical Systems Enterprise, Business Central, .NET, and PowerBI.
Experience with Office 365 (Outlook, Teams, Word, Excel) at the Intermediate level strongly preferred.
